Where to stay in Hulmeville

Center City
Known for its fascinating museums and acclaimed art galleries, there's plenty to explore in Center City. Check out top attractions like Pennsylvania Convention Center and Philadelphia Museum of Art, and jump on the metro at 11th St Station or 8th St Station to see more of the city.

South Philadelphia
Travellers choose South Philadelphia for its great live music. Hop aboard the metro at Snyder Station or Tasker Morris Station and check out top sights like Citizens Bank Park.

Old City
Known for its abundant dining options and interesting museums, there's plenty to explore in Old City. Top attractions like Elfreth's Alley and Betsy Ross House are major draws, and you can catch the metro at 2nd St. Station or 5th St. Station to see more of the city.

Rittenhouse Square
While you're in Rittenhouse Square, take in top sights like Walnut Street or Rittenhouse Row, and hop on the metro to see more of the city at 15th-16th & Locust Station or 19th St Station.

University City
Travellers choose University City for its ample dining options. Hop aboard the metro at Penn Medicine Station or 33rd St Station and check out top sights like University of Pennsylvania Museum of Archaeology and Anthropology.
